Bend had rain showers off and on today so I let the rain soak the bugs while I headed into town to do some shopping. I took a different road into town which turned out to be a gravel forest road. It was a very well maintained road and was a very pretty drive. I saw several trail heads along the way that I will need to check out later. 

Using my GPS, I went to several stores and had a quick tour of Bend. First, of course, I headed to REI where my dividend for this year paid for my Merrill shoes that I replace every year. I also found an awesome book called Bend, Overall by Scott Cook. It is primarily about hiking trails, but also touches on museums, lakes, caves and other things to see in the area. There is so much to do here that it may take me several years to see it all.
